This salvaged life buoy comes from the container ship Aphrodite, built in 1999 and registered under the Monrovia flag. Featuring its original bright orange surface with bold “Aphrodite” and “Monrovia” markings, this life buoy reflects years of service at sea. The white reflective bands and attached rope enhance its authentic maritime character, showing signs of use that make it a perfect nautical collectible or display piece.
Carefully salvaged, this life buoy offers a unique connection to maritime history and the global shipping trade.
